I also want to share my timeline and hope this will be useful and help anxious people like me :D

  1. Aug 19, 2023 - ITA for OINP Employer Job Offer: Foreign Worker stream
  2. Sep 03, 2023 - OINP application submitted
  3. Nov 15, 2023 - DIP for OINP
  4. Dec 17, 2023 - Request for additional documents
  5. Jan 7, 2024 - OINP nomination application approved
  6. Mar 12, 2024 - my attorney submitted PNP FSW application
  7. June 26, 2024 - AOR, Biometry request
  8. July 3, 2024 - Biometry pass
For some reason I can't track my application using https://ircc-tracker-suivi.apps.cic.gc.ca/en - it said that application not found. But as I understand this happens. I called 1-888-242-2100, and found out that my status is Background check, so I hope he doesn't hang there for a long time. But, as I understand it, the countdown of the expected review time has now begun.
